What is an “Artificial General Engineer”?
To understand Prometheus, you have to look at what it isn’t. Bezos has explicitly stated that the company is not building “world models” for robotics. Instead, Prometheus is building an “artificial general engineer.” While the traditional AI is concerned with knowledge work (text, code, images), Prometheus deals with the physical economy (jet engines, microchips, cars).
This isn’t an AI assistant that writes about engineering; it is a system designed to do engineering. Give it a physics framework and a set of constraints, and it will design, simulate, and optimize physical objects—jet engines, medical devices, microchips, and automobiles—for weight, cost, and safety.
The ultimate prize here is time compression. “Ask a jet-engine maker for the same engine with ten per cent more thrust, and you may wait a decade. Prometheus wants that loop in months.” — Jeff Bezos
Why AI Stalled at the Factory Floor
Software ate the world, but AI stopped at the factory gates for one simple reason: the data to train an artificial general engineer does not exist on the public internet.
LLMs succeeded because the internet provided a near-infinite, low-cost corpus of human thought. Manufacturing reasoning, however, is locked away. It lives inside proprietary archives, test rigs, and the tacit knowledge inside engineers’ heads. None of it is written down in a format an AI scraper can read.
Prometheus is overcoming this digital-to-physical divide through a brilliant two-pronged strategy:
1. Operating the Engineering Stack
In 2025, Prometheus quietly acquired General Agents, creators of an AI system called Ace that can operate computers via video-language-action models. By teaching an AI agent to navigate the software interfaces that human engineers live in—CAD tools, simulation suites, and product-lifecycle management (PLM) systems—Prometheus creates a bridge for the AI to interact directly with existing workflows.
2. M&A as the Web Crawler
This is where the story gets fascinating. Rumours are swirling that Bezos is raising a separate, massive $100 billion investment vehicle backed by major institutional players like JPMorgan’s Jamie Dimon and the UAE’s sovereign wealth fund. The goal? To buy up traditional industrial and manufacturing companies.
This isn’t just a standard private equity buyout play. In the AI era, mergers and acquisitions are the new web crawler. M&A pay out in three ways:
- Data: Real-world data to the Prometheus training models.
- Captive Testing: Provides a built-in sandbox to deploy, iterate, and prove the software.
- Margin Capture: Prometheus pockets 100% of the efficiency gains as the owner, not just a vendor.
If you strip away the Silicon Valley nomenclature, the structure Bezos is pioneering looks remarkably familiar. It is a Berkshire Hathaway built for the 21st century.
Where Warren Buffett buys cash-flowing industrial giants to harvest their capital, Bezos’s vehicle will buy them to harvest their data.
In an AI landscape where software models are constantly cloned, open-sourced, and distilled, algorithmic advantages are fleeting. The ultimate economic moat isn’t the code—it’s the messy, proprietary, highly guarded data generated by running a real-world turbine line or automotive plant.
By buying the factories, Prometheus isn’t just building a software tool. They are verticalizing the physical economy, owning both the brain and the body of the next industrial revolution.
